Dover Precision Components Expands Innovation Lab to Industrial Testing

Testing is not just an option, it's a competitive advantage, according to Burak Bekisli, Director of Innovation at Dover Precision Components. The company is now opening its 12,000-square-foot Houston facility to external original equipment manufacturers and end users to accelerate product development for rotating and reciprocating machinery.

The expansion allows engineers to leverage the company’s flagship laboratory for a variety of critical tasks, ranging from early-stage concept validation to final performance verification. By offering these services, Dover aims to function as an extension of its clients' internal engineering teams, providing access to specialized test rigs designed to replicate complex, real-world operating environments.

Services now available to the market include prototype optimization, failure mode analysis, and accelerated lifecycle testing. The lab also provides sophisticated characterization—covering thermal, mechanical, chemical, and tribological properties—which is increasingly vital for emerging sectors like the hydrogen economy. In these high-pressure environments, the lab’s testing capabilities assist engineers in identifying and mitigating wear challenges before components reach full-scale production.
